When it comes to ensuring safety for children and pets round pools, putting in a fence is an important step. However, many owners discover themselves making frequent pool fence errors that might compromise safety and lead to legal challenges (Utilizing glass in coastal staircase projects Sunshine Coast Qld). Recognizing these pitfalls is important for a safe and compliant pool space


One frequent error is neglecting the local regulations. Each state or municipality has specific codes governing pool safety features. Failing to familiarize oneself with these regulations can result in fines and the need for expensive modifications. Often, owners believe they can design their own safety measures with out considering legal requirements. This overconfidence can lead to severe implications, particularly if an incident occurs.


Another widespread mistake is inadequate fence height. Many regulations specify a minimum height for pool fences to discourage kids from climbing over them. A fence that doesn't meet these height requirements can simply be scaled by curious youngsters. Installing a fence that is too low poses a significant risk, because it compromises the very function of getting a barrier around the pool.

The type of material used for the fence also plays a significant role in safety. Choosing supplies which are weak or prone to break can result in fast deterioration and a compromised boundary. Wooden fences, while aesthetically pleasing, may rot or warp over time, creating gaps that youngsters can slip via. Opting for extra sturdy materials like aluminum or vinyl can enhance the longevity and effectiveness of the pool barrier.


Another often-overlooked side is the position of the fence. Some householders mistakenly position the fence far sufficient away from the water’s edge to make the pool area look larger or more inviting. This can be misleading, as it might allow for simple access to the pool area from throughout the yard. A fence should ideally enclose the pool closely to forestall access immediately from inside the house.

Additionally, the gates in pool fences are crucial for security. Common mistakes include using gates that do not self-close or self-latch. These options are essential to prevent children from wandering freely into the pool area. Failing to install a gate that correctly features can render the whole fence ineffective. Regular maintenance checks on these gates should be a priority to make sure they proceed to be safe over time.


Maintenance of the fence itself is another space typically uncared for. Over time, fences can develop weaknesses, whether from put on and tear or environmental factors. Homeowners sometimes forget that fences require regular inspections and repairs to stay safe. An missed gap or crack in the fence's materials can present an unimpeded entry level to young children or pets.


Some individuals may choose to install a fence themselves with out enough data. DIY initiatives can be cost-effective however typically result in subpar installations. Incorrect measurements or improper anchoring could cause fences to turn into unstable, making them much less dependable. When it comes to safety installations such as pool fences, consulting with professionals is a prudent choice to make sure confidence in the job carried out.

Transparency in design can be necessary. Using materials that obstruct visibility can create blind spots, leaving dad and mom unaware of their children's activities near the poolside. A fence should permit caregivers to take care of sightlines to the pool area at all times. Using transparent supplies or designs that don't hinder the view ensures steady supervision.


The possibility of further safety features may additionally be missed. Many owners might imagine that merely putting in a fence is enough for safety. However, adding alarms to the gates or using pool covers can tremendously improve protecting measures. These extra options can function deterrents, alerting owners and caregivers to unauthorized access or potential risks.

How excessive should a pool fence be?


The beneficial height for a pool fence is no less than four ft. This height is often required by legislation to prevent unauthorized access by young children and pets.

Are gaps under the pool fence a problem?


Yes, gaps underneath the fence mustn't exceed 4 inches. Larger gaps can allow youngsters or pets to slip underneath, compromising safety.

Can I rely solely on a pool cowl for safety?


No, pool covers aren't dependable safety barriers. They should complement, not exchange, a proper fence designed to keep kids and pets safe.
